The Computer Science Teacher Assistant primarily supports computer science teachers in educational settings, focusing on tech-related coursework. A Teaching Assistant has a broader role, assisting teachers across various subjects, including computer science. Both roles require similar educational backgrounds but differ in scope and subject focus.

Why are you interested in being a computer science teacher assistant?

A computer science teacher assistant supports educators by helping students understand programming concepts, troubleshoot technical issues, and facilitate hands-on activities. This role often involves working with programming languages, educational tools, and maintaining a positive learning environment, making it suitable for individuals interested in technology and education.

What are some common challenges faced by computer science teacher assistants when supporting students with diverse learning backgrounds?

Computer Science Teacher Assistants often encounter the challenge of assisting students who have varying levels of programming experience and learning styles. Balancing the needs of beginners with those of more advanced students can require adaptability and strong communication skills. Additionally, TAs must be able to clarify complex concepts, troubleshoot code, and foster an inclusive classroom environment where all students feel comfortable asking questions. Collaboration with the lead instructor and other TAs is essential for effectively managing these diverse needs and ensuring all students receive adequate support.

What does a computer science teacher assistant do?

A Computer Science Teacher Assistant supports instructors in teaching computer science courses by helping prepare materials, assisting students with programming assignments, grading homework, and sometimes leading lab sessions or discussion groups. They act as a bridge between students and the instructor, providing additional support and clarification on course topics. Teacher assistants may also help troubleshoot technical issues during classes and offer feedback to help students improve their understanding of computer science concepts.

What are the key skills and qualifications needed to thrive as a computer science teacher assistant, and why are they important?

To thrive as a Computer Science Teacher Assistant, you need a solid understanding of computer science fundamentals, programming languages, and typically at least a bachelor's degree in computer science or a related field. Familiarity with educational platforms, coding environments (such as Python, Java, or C++), and learning management systems is often required. Strong communication, patience, and the ability to explain complex concepts simply are crucial soft skills that help support students effectively. These skills and qualities ensure that students receive clear guidance, reinforce their learning, and foster a positive educational environment.

As one of the nation's largest Catholic universities and among the fastest-growing private doctoral institutions in the U.S., Sacred Heart University is a national leader in shaping higher education for the 21st century. SHU offers more than 100 undergraduate, graduate and doctoral programs on its Fairfield, Conn., campus. Sacred Heart also has a campus in Dingle, Ireland, and offers online programs. Nearly 10,000 students attend the University's nine colleges and schools: College of Arts & Sciences; School of Communication, Media & the Arts; School of Social Work; School of Performing Arts; College of Health Professions; the Isabelle Farrington College of Education & Human Development; the Jack Welch College of Business & Technology; School of Computer Science & Engineering and the Dr. Susan L. Davis, R.N., & Richard J. Henley College of Nursing. Sacred Heart, a Laudato Si' campus, stands out from other Catholic universities as it was established to be led by the laity. This contemporary Catholic university is rooted in the rich Catholic intellectual tradition and the liberal arts and, at the same time, cultivates students to be forward thinkers who enact change-in their own lives, professions and in their communities. The Princeton Review includes SHU in its Best 391 Colleges: 2026 Edition and Best Business Schools: 2025 Edition. Sacred Heart is home to the award-winning, NPR-affiliate station, WSHU Public Radio; a Division I athletics program and an impressive performing arts program that includes choir, band, dance and theatre.

Sacred Heart University (SHU), located in Fairfield, Connecticut, houses its School of Computing and Engineering (SCE) within the College of Arts and Sciences. SCE offers two graduate programs (M.S. in Computer Science & Information Technology and M.S. in Cybersecurity), seven undergraduate Bachelor of Science programs-Computer Science, Information Technology, Game Design & Development, Cybersecurity, Computer Engineering, Electrical Engineering, and Mechanical Engineering-and several graduate certificate programs.
